0500 Hrs start up, this morning....:SaluteandRun::SaluteandRun::SaluteandRun::SaluteandRun:

Layout work.

.1178150630_MarchProjectside1layout.JPG.ce7c0195c55a38bb8efcdc28a45d757b.JPG

Marked as Front, Back, Top, Bottom, and Inside...then a baseline..

663446372_MarchProjectbaseline.JPG.8e4d72cd86d76e598220e1170ec5c64a.JPG

Layout tools..:ChinScratch:

1453061376_MarchProjectlayouttools.JPG.a07acbbc26021c3e0faa035724184529.JPG

Layout lines to cut..

886658515_MarchProjectcutlines.JPG.da93c7f58ed4686799107f02ef73b160.JPG

Drop the panel down in the vise, get the shop stool ready...:ChinScratch:

1251631520_MarchProjectshopstoolready.JPG.03305083ccab3bfd793b16181a70e54c.JPG

Run a saw for a bit..

324951528_MarchProjectsawwork.JPG.89aa3938bdd2a468733e48ada01be4ff.JPG

Set up a chopping block....

1290407650_MarchProjectPinshalfwaychop.JPG.8a5a2d6de56b02dad8e3610d700bad95.JPG

Outside face first, chop halfway down...flip over..

1941739780_MarchProjectPinsdone.JPG.07aea096a4d428c4be10419fe9003960.JPG

Pins are done...use them to mark out the tails....make a bunch of bandsaw cuts..INSIDE the waste lines:OldManSmiley:

986741642_MarchProjecttailshalfchopped.JPG.3db5c576a942c007a9ade7aa2e95351d.JPG

Chop halfway down, and then flip over..

1926000088_MarchProjectTailsdone.JPG.48125efb2a5fe2eb3af591adc9a8e922.JPG

Then try a dry fit..:TwoThumbsUp:

.1886801341_MarchProjectdryfit1.JPG.41a934bce6a4cbf4abb5e7bedada4fcd.JPG

Close enough...repeat for the other end of the back panel...dry fit..

226855123_MarchProject2nddryfitcorner.JPG.cf67eceb92d4569be1b14488189470ed.JPG

Back 2 corners are done...for now...leaves 2 more to do...:TwoThumbsUp:

932626116_MarchProjectnext2corners.JPG.d29bb67b78d3a09f7c12b948af573ee5.JPG

This is the top of the box...These corners will get dovetailed....below this is the drawer.  Front top needs a rebate, to help hold the floor of the upper compartment..B)
